November to January are the coldest months, with a mean temperature of twenty °C. The wet year lasts from September to January with significant rains which can trigger floods and have an affect on tourism. The city's dry year is between February and May, when the temperature becomes very moderate with moderate temperature and fewer humid.[31]

Ba Mu Temple is actually a newly reopened but outdated temple intricate noted for its elaborate 3-entrance gate design. The gate was initially constructed from the 17th Century somewhere else and it has given that been moved in this article and renovated.
